Which Ford SUVs and Trucks Suit Active Families or Outdoor Enthusiasts in Gainesville?

Quick Answer: The Ford Explorer, Expedition, Bronco, and F-150 deliver spacious seating, adaptable cargo space, and advanced safety features, making them ideal for family outings and weekend adventures.
For families in Gainesville, the Ford Explorer stands out as a versatile three-row SUV, accommodating up to seven passengers. It features tri-zone climate control to keep everyone comfortable on school runs or trips to the Frank Buck Zoo. With its flexible cargo space, including a fold-flat second and third row, there’s ample room for strollers, sports gear, or picnic supplies when heading to Leonard Park. Plus, the Ford Co-Pilot360⢠safety technology ensures peace of mind with features like the Lane-Keeping System and Pre-Collision Assist.
If your adventures call for even more space, the Ford Expedition offers a robust option with seating for up to eight. Perfect for larger families or group outings, its generous cargo capacity can handle everything from camping gear for a weekend at Lake Texoma to equipment for DIY home projects. The available rear entertainment system keeps kids engaged during longer drives, making it an excellent choice for community events like the Medal of Honor parade.
For outdoor enthusiasts, the Ford Bronco brings a rugged design and off-road capabilities, ideal for exploring the natural beauty around Gainesville. With features like the Terrain Management System⢠and removable doors, itās ready for weekend camping or hiking trips. Plus, the Broncoās flexible seating and cargo space can adapt to carry all your outdoor gear, whether youāre headed to a local trail or a camping site.
Lastly, the Ford F-150 pickup truck is perfect for those who need a workhorse for both family activities and heavy-duty tasks. With a towing capacity of up to 11,600 lbs, it can haul trailers for weekend getaways or equipment for home improvement projects. The F-150’s spacious cabin, equipped with available Pro Power Onboardā¢, provides power for tools or devices on the go, making it a practical choice for busy families who enjoy hands-on activities.

Are Fordās Safety Features and Tech Worth It for Gainesville Commuters and Families?
Quick Answer: AbsolutelyāFordās advanced safety and driver-assist technologies offer invaluable support for busy families and commuters navigating Gainesville’s roads, ensuring peace of mind during every journey.
Most new Ford models, such as the F-150 and Explorer, come equipped with Ford Co-Pilot360⢠2.0, which includes features like Pre-Collision Assist with Automatic Emergency Braking, Lane-Keeping System, and BLIS® (Blind Spot Information System). These technologies are particularly useful on local routes like I-35 and U.S. 82, where quick reactions can prevent accidents, especially during hectic school drop-off times or in unpredictable weather conditions common in Texas. For instance, when driving through the rain on a hilly road, having adaptive cruise control and lane-keeping assist can make a significant difference in maintaining control and safety.
In addition to safety, Fordās infotainment systems keep families connected and entertained. Features like SYNCĀ® 4 with a 12-inch Capacitive Touchscreen, Apple CarPlayā¢, and Android Auto⢠are standard on many models, ensuring that everyone stays comfortable and informed during rides to the Frank Buck Zoo or community events like Depot Day. Plus, with available 5G LTE Wi-Fi Hotspot Connectivity, you can stream your favorite shows or music while waiting in carpool lines, making every trip more enjoyable.

How Do Ford Crossovers Compare for Everyday Versatility?
Quick Answer: The Ford Escape and Explorer offer flexible cargo options, available all-wheel drive, and advanced driver-assist technologies, making them strong choices for versatile daily use.
The Ford Escape features a sliding second row and available AWD, providing adaptability for various cargo and passenger needs.
The Ford Explorer offers three rows of seating and over 85 cubic feet of cargo space on select models, along with a suite of driver-assist technologies that enhance safety and convenience.
